 If you want to read and write from OS to OS, then make sure you se the windows partition to FAT32. My guess is you have windows installed already ? You may be able to make another partition and set it to VFAT otherwise.

 Just make sure you use  " GRUB " for the booatloader. It's alot easier if your not familiar.

If this is your first time doing anything with linux you may want to install virtual box on windows and then install any linux distro in a virtual machine  on top of windows so you don't have to do a dual boot.
